Akbar Malik & Ors. v. M/s. Bombaywala & Ors.

Permission to file transfer petition is allowed.

(A.K. Sikri and Ashok Bhushan, JJ.)

Akbar Malik & Ors. _____________________________ Petitioner(s)

v.

M/s. Bombaywala & Ors. ________________________ Respondent(s)

Transfer Petition(s) (Civil) No(s)./2017 [Arising out of Transfer Petition (Civil) Diary No(s). 27979/2017], decided on November 3, 2017

The Order of the court was delivered by

Order

1. Permission to file transfer petition is allowed.

2. Issue notice.

3. Mr. Aman Varma, Mr. Kush Chaturvedi & Mr. Shriram P. Pingle, Advocates-on-Record, accept notice.

4. With the consent of the parties we have heard the petition finally. Having regard to the circumstances explained in the petition, the transfer petition is allowed. Writ Petition No. 5005 of 2017 titled as “Bombaywala v. State of Maharashtra” be heard along with SLP(C) Nos. 9652-9653 of 2017.

5. The learned counsel for the parties submit that they will file a copy of the record within four weeks. In these circumstances, the record need not be called for.
